The first step to care for your old leather sofa is to wipe it clean using a clean, dry cloth to remove any loose dirt and dust. Make sure you dampen the cloth, but not enough that it drips, as this can damage the leather. Start at the top and work your way downward by wiping and washing the cloth frequently to avoid spreading dirt. When you're done wiping off any excess cleaner with a clean cloth and let the couch dry completely.

You can buy a range of commercial wet-cleaning products, but you can also do it yourself with some pantry items. For instance, you could make a leather wipe by using warm, soapy water and microfiber towels or a washcloth. Then, soak your cloth into a solution of distilled water, mild natural soap, and a small amount of soap. Then squeeze the cloth until it is damp but not dripping. Start to clean the couch with the cloth, sweeping the back and sides of the couch, as well as the armrests and cushions. Rinse your cloth as often as you need to make sure that you don't get too much soap on the leather.

When the sofa is dry and clean, use a soft cloth to apply a thin coat of leather conditioner. Test the leather conditioner on a small part of your sofa prior to applying it. A good leather conditioner will keep your sofa soft and supple, while also protecting it from oil, water, and food spills.

Rubbing alcohol is a fantastic solution for stubborn stains such as ink. Just dab a bit of isopropyl alcohol on the stain and watch it disappear. If you're working with wax or chewing gum, just a few ice cubes will do the trick. Place the ice over the chewing gum or wax and allow it to rest for a few minutes.
